Agroecology Student Workshop

 

2007-2008
Click here for more information

Tuesday, January 15th, 2008
Florida International University
Graham Center, Room 243
Registration at 9:00 am

9:30-11:00  "Agroecology and Sustainable Agriculture: Challenges and                   Opportunities”
                  Panel:
                  • Dr. Steve Gliessman, Alfred Heller Professor of Agroecology
                     University of California, Santa Cruz
                  • Dr. Eva Worden, Worden Farms, Certified Organic Produce
                     Punta Cana, Florida
                  • And More

11:00-12:15 Poster presentations: "Agroecology and Natural Resources
                  Management: Case Studies from the US and Around the World"
                   -Topics for Poster Presentations: Urban gardens, local
                   agriculture, organic food pricing, best management practices,
                   pesticide bio-remediation, water harvesting technology,
                   international food problems & solutions, etc.

12:15-1:00   Lunch (will be provided)

1:00-4:30    Student and faculty oral presentations.

 

2006-2007

Pictures from the 2006 workshop

LOCATION: ECS 157 (Agroecology lab)
DATE: Monday, October 23rd 2006
TIME: 1pm to 4pm

1:00 to 2:30 Session 1
Giddy Bobeche: Socio-economic and ecological dimensions of organic agriculture in South Florida.

Melissa Abdo
: Linking livelihoods to the landscape: integrating local ecological knowledge to improve sustainable agriculture and biodiversity conservation in Indonesia

Jose Pacheco
: Biological control of Brazilian pepper.

Cristina Clark-Cuadrado
: Summer internship with the USDA-NRCS.

Katherine Valverde
: Summer internship in organic farming.

2:30 to 3:00 Tea Break and Informal Poster Session

3:00 to 4:00 Session 2
Cassandra Quave: Integration and management of plants as functional foods and medicines in home gardens and vineyards of Southern Italy.

Kathy Stone: Policies to mitigate ecological effects of shrimp farming: A comparative study of Florida and Karnataka, India.

Christina Hoffman
: geo-spatial analysis of water-demand-use with in the Mara River Basin (MRB) in Eastern Africa.

Nasser Brahim
: Trees and tea in the East African Highlands.

Seema Sah
: Effect of flooding on arbuscular mycorrhizal colonization in bean plans.
